Shutdown Maintenance Equipment: Planning Access for Turnarounds

In a turnaround, availability beats price. Here is how experienced planners size and protect their access fleet.

Aerial Spider Access Company Technical Team · 19 December 2025 · 7 min read

Size the fleet against the critical path

Map every work front that needs elevated access, then allocate machines by height and footprint. Confining several trades to one shared lift is the fastest way to lose shutdown days.

Standby machines are insurance, not luxury

On a 21-day turnaround, a single day of lost access can outweigh the entire standby rental cost. Pre-position at least one spare unit per critical height class.

Certification and permits

Spark arrestors, gas testing compatibility, colour-coded tags and operator certificates should be verified weeks before mobilisation, not at the gate.
